At the Choeun Ek memorial site, Cambodians marked Anger Day on May 20 - with re-enactments of Khmer Rouge torture and executions.<br /><br />Choeun Ek, from 17 kilometres south of the Cambodian capital Phnom Penh, is one of the sites known as the Killing Fields - where the Khmer Rouge executed over more than a million people between 1975 and 1979.<br />http://www.euronews.net/
